Cleveland Browns Upset Ravens to Lead AFC North

The Cleveland vs Ravens Game

The Cleveland Browns vs. Baltimore Ravens American football game seemed like it would be another win under Raven’s belt. But then Cleveland took back the win and held it down in an unexpected comeback.

It’s safe to say the Ravens are not happy about losing the AFC North game while having a several-point advantage. In fact, they had 14 points over Cleveland in the last quarter and it seems like that advantage got to the Ravens’ head as they let the Browns score 16 points. Additionally, with the loss came a break in the Ravens’ win streak and allowed Cleveland to come closer to Baltimore with a score of 6-3. Which is something the Ravens should take seriously as both teams are in the most competitive division of the NFL.

It was a very disappointing loss on the Raven’s end as the score was 31-17 as the game entered the fourth quarter. However, on the other hand, it was a great comeback and one of many to add to the Cleveland Browns team. During the fourth quarter, the great comeback of Cleveland’s, sparked as Elijah Moore performed a touchdown catch. However, the winning shot was made by Dustin Hopkins, who was assisted by Deshaun Watson with a field goal. The way this money shot went down goes as follows. The game only had about five minutes left, and the previously injured Deshaun Watson guided Hopkins through the Ravens’ defense and allowed him to throw that winning shot and give Cleveland the win.

ClevelandDeshaun Watson’s injuries

As Deshaun Watson helped make the Cleveland winning shot, it came at a costly price. Afterward, Watson suffered an ankle injury during the Cleveland vs Ravens match. This injury occurred towards the end of the first half it was caused when Watson was tackled by Jadeveon Clowney. Jadeveon is actually a former teammate of Watson.

The final play was being executed and Watson went into the locker room and had his ankle looked at. But as he was getting his ankle examined, there was a replacement quarterback to go perform the final play. As Watson was allowed back into the second half of the game, he was playing despite the pain. Additionally, Deshaun didn’t just play well, he made all 14 pass attempts and did a touchdown in both the third and fourth quarters. As soon as all the fun was over and the game was won by Cleveland, Watson underwent an MRI scan for his ankle injury.

Myles Garret’s defense stats

While the Cleveland and Ravens match went on, Myles Garret had a decent defense over the Ravens as he had a combined three tackles and assists during the whole match.

The Expectations for Cleveland vs Steelers Game

As many know how the last game went for the Cleveland team against the Steelers the tension is rising as the teams collide for another match against each other. The Cleveland team has a history of losing to the Steelers but will that be the same case for this new game or in other words will history repeat itself.

Many people are putting their money on the Steelers. Due to the Steelers winning 75 percent of their games at home. This is where the game between the Browns and the Steelers will take place. But the Browns have a 45.4 percent chance of winning this game with the Steelers taking a 54.65 chance.
